Cyrex Array 14 — Mucosal Immune Reactivity Screen™

The mucosal immune system — particularly secretory IgA (sIgA) — is the first line of immune defence in the gut, respiratory tract, and mucous membranes. Array 14 assesses sIgA-mediated immune reactivity against 28 dietary and environmental antigens at the mucosal surface, revealing immune activation patterns not detectable by standard serum IgG/IgA testing.

Antigens Tested (Salivary IgA):

  • Wheat/Gluten fractions (α-Gliadin, Glutenin)
  • Cow’s Milk proteins (Casein, Whey)
  • Egg (Albumin)
  • Soy protein
  • Corn (Zein)
  • Peanut
  • Almond
  • Sesame
  • Yeast (Baker’s and Brewer’s)
  • Bacterial antigens: LPS, H. pylori, Candida albicans
  • Gluten cross-reactive foods: Rice, Potato, Chocolate
  • Environmental: Dust mite, Mould antigens (Aspergillus, Alternaria)

Why Mucosal IgA Matters:

Many gut and respiratory reactions are mediated at the mucosal surface via sIgA before they show up in the bloodstream. This panel reveals early-stage mucosal immune activation that serum tests miss, and is particularly useful for respiratory food allergies, digestive symptoms without positive serum tests, and oral allergy syndrome.

Sample Type:

Saliva — simple collection at home.
